パスワード式画像掲示板

 内容
 この掲示板はパスワード入力によって表示されます。画像のアップロードができます。

 特徴
 ●パスワードを入力しないと掲示板が表示されません。
 ●画像をアップロードできます。画像は指定のサイズに縮小表示できます。
 ●自分の記事の[修正]をクリックすれば修正、削除ができます。
 ●新しい記事は見出しを色帯で表示します。その表示時間も指定できます。

 表示例

掲示板

パスワードを入力して下さい。




[HOME]掲示板

名前
メール
HP
題名

内容
画像
修正キー (英数8文字以内)

 画像のアップロード  管理者  2002年12月12日(木) 0:11 HP Mail
・画像を掲示板に直接アップロードできます。
・画像は指定のサイズに縮小表示されます。
 画像をクリックすれば実サイズに表示されます。

   訪問者 2002年12月12日(木) 0:16   HP
新しい記事は見出しを色帯で表示します。

全 7件  [管理]
実際に動作しているサンプルが こちら にありますのでご覧下さい。

 設置手順
No 項 目 内  容
1 ファイルダウンロード 下記をクリックして圧縮ファイルをダウンロードします。
  bbs42.lzh
2 ファイルの解凍 圧縮ファイルを解凍すると下記のファイルが生成されます。解凍ツールは「+Lhaca」が推奨です。
  <ディレクトリ構成>
     |---bbsdata (ディレクトリ)
     |---cgi-lib.pl
     |---bbs42.cgi
3 スクリプトの変更 bbs42.cgi は最初の行に下記のようにPerlパスが記述してあります。
この記述がサーバ側で定められた指定と異なる場合は修正して下さい。(参考
  /usr/bin/perl
4 HPページの記述 HPページで本CGIへ下記のリンクを張ります。
  http://xxxx/bbs42.cgi
5 ファイル転送 上記のファイル及びHPページをサーバへ転送します。
サーバによってCGIとHTMLのディレクトリが分離している場合は、bbsdataディレクトリをCGIとHTMLの両方のディレクトリに転送します。
6 パーミッションの設定 アクセス権 (パーミッション)を下表のように設定します。
但し、サーバによってパーミッションが指定されている場合は、それに従って下さい。
ファイル名 アクセス権 備 考
bbs42.cgi 755  
cgi-lib.pl 644  
bbsdataディレクトリ 777  
bbs.cgi、no.txt、
option.txt
666 本CGIを実行すると自動設定されますが、設定されない場合は手動で設定して下さい。
ファイルはbbsdataディレクトリの中にあります。
7 実行 上記のHPページでリンクをクリックすると本CGIを表示します。

 使用方法
 ●ログイン
  ・ログイン用のパスワードを入力します。パスワードの初期値は「cgi」です。
  ・パスワードは下記の「管理」で変更できます。
  ・掲示板に一度書込むとパスワードは自動入力されます。

 ●投稿
  ・画像は「参照」をクリックして画像ファイルを入力します。
    アップロード可能な画像のファイル形式: JPG、GIF、PNG    最大ファイルサイズ: 200KB
  ・大きい画像は縮小表示されます。その場合は画像をクリックすれば実サイズで表示します。
  ・内容欄に記載したURL(http://)は自動的にリンクされます。
  ・一度書込むと、名前・メール・HP・修正キーは自動入力されます。
  ・返信記事を書込む場合は親記事の「返信」をクリックします。
  ・新しい書込みは指定された見出し色帯と時間で表示されます。

 ●修正、削除
  ・投稿後は自分の記事の「修正」をクリックすれば修正、削除ができます。
   但し、「修正キー」が必要な場合もありますので投稿時に入力しておいて下さい。
  ・親記事を削除するとそれに対する全ての返信記事も削除されます。
  ・管理者が記事を修正、削除する場合は、「修正」をクリックし修正キーに管理パスワードを入力します。
   管理パスワードは全ての記事に対して有効です。

 ●管理
  ・掲示板の右下にある「管理」をクリックします。パスワードは初期値が「cgi」です。
タイトル

コメント
ホームURL
壁紙
画像格納ディレクトリ
画像読出ディレクトリ
カラーコード
基本背景色
基本文字色
タイトル色
題名色
名前色
見出し帯色
新記事の見出し帯色
記事背景色
記事枠色
新記事の表示時間 時間
記事表示 件/ページ(親記事数)  最大件(親/返信記事の合計)  表示幅px
画像表示 横maxpx  縦maxpx
ログインパスワード (英数8文字以内)
管理パスワード (英数8文字以内)

 タイトル 最上部に表示するタイトルを入力します。
 コメント ログイン時のパスワード入力画面に表示するコメントを入力します。
 ホームURL 左上部に表示するホームへの戻り先を指定します。
 壁紙 壁紙の画像アドレスを入力します。壁紙を使用しない場合は空白にします。
 画像格納ディレクトリ bbsdataディレクトリを絶対パス又は本CGIからの相対パスで指定します。
サーバによってCGIとHTMLのディレクトリが分離している場合は、「設置手順5」で転送したHTML用ディレクトリのbbsdataのパスを指定します。http://のURLでは指定できません。
 (例) ./bbsdata、 ../xxxx/bbsdata、 /xxxx/bbsdata
 画像読出ディレクトリ bbsdataディレクトリをURL又は本CGIからの相対パスで指定します。
サーバによってCGIとHTMLのディレクトリが分離している場合は、「設置手順5」で転送したHTML用ディレクトリのbbsdataを http://のURLで指定します。
 (例) ./bbsdata、 http://xxxx/bbsdata
 基本背景色・・・ 各色をカラーコードで指定します。
 新記事の表示時間 新しい記事に対して「新記事の見出し帯色」を表示する時間を指定します。
 記事表示 ・ページ当りの記事表示件数を指定します。
・記事の最大件数を指定します。最大件数を越えると古い記事から自動的に削除されます。
・記事の表示幅を指定します。
 画像表示 画像を表示する最大サイズを指定します。このサイズを越えると縮小表示されます。
表示サイズはその設定後の画像入力から有効になります。
 ログインパスワード ログイン用のパスワードを入力します。英数字で8文字以内です。
このパスワードを変更した場合は、ブラウザを一度閉じて下さい。
 管理パスワード 管理画面に入る為のパスワードを入力します。英数字で8文字以内です。


 改版履歴
リリース日 対象 版数 改版内容
 2004.3.11 bbs42.cgi V1.0 初版
 2005.10.29 bbs42.cgi V2.0 全面変更。旧版とのデータ互換性はありません。
 2006.1.14 bbs42.cgi V2.1 画像の表示を修正



CGI-design